Chloroplast, often known as the kitchen of the cell, is where photosynthetic reactions combining light energy from the Sun into chemical energy [Glucose] that is stored as food. They contain a Green Color Pigment called 'Chlorophyll' that initiates the process, but Chlorophyll isn't an organelle, in fact, it is one of the elements of Chloroplasts. Similarly, Thylakoids are membrane-bound elements inside Chloroplast that aid in photosynthesis. While Mitochondria, [Power Houses Of Cells] generate energy for various processes in cells through ATP-Generations.
